One of the first signs people with gum disease in Raleigh, NC, may notice is redness or tenderness around the gum line. This indicates that bacteria have spread and are attacking the delicate tissues supporting the teeth. As the infection worsens, pockets of pus develop around the roots and separate the gums from the teeth. This painful process may cause teeth to fall out, but this may not be the most serious effect. Scientists have discovered the same bacteria found in gum disease is associated with colon cancer, heart disease, diabetes and other health problems. Some believe the link may be from infection entering the bloodstream through the open wounds below the gum line.
As any dentist in Raleigh, NC, will tell their patients, gum disease can be treated. However, more severe cases may require surgery. At most dental practices, this could mean creating incisions in the gums to separate them from the teeth for a proper cleaning. Dr. Naran uses laser dentistry rather than sharp dental tools so his patients do not have to undergo the trauma of traditional methods. The LANAP® protocol uses the PerioLase® MVP-7™, a fine-tipped laser that can access the affected area without cutting the gums with a scalpel. An ultrasonic tool removes tartar, and the specially calibrated beam of light targets bacteria without harming healthy tissue. The laser also cauterizes the wounds to prevent excess bleeding and stimulates new bone growth for a fast recovery.
